A familair face will lead Terang Mortlake into its first season of smnior women’s football.
Shae De Francesco has appointed to coach the Bloods for the 2026 Western Victoria Female Football League season.
De Francesco is a formr vice captain of the Bloods under 18s team and was runner up the best and fairest.
She played for Modewarre in the Barwon league last season.
Last season, she continued to develop her football with Modewarre Football & Netball Club in the Barwon Football Netball League, further building her experience at a high level.
Her talents extend beyond football. During the current cricket season, Shae played with Simpson Cricket Club, earning the prestigious Colac Herald Cricket Star Player award. She also represented at representative level cricket, where she was named Player of the Year.
